Voltage
120 VAC, 60 Hz, single phase.
The DDC 6-10 is universal-input (100–240 VAC, 50/60 Hz), but on this skid it is fed from the 120 V control bus, not the 240 V leg. The 240 V split-phase service feeds only the three VFDs.

Per-Pump Switching
Each pump's L1 (hot) leg is switched by a Form-A relay on P2-08TRS #1 (Slot 2). Neutral is unbroken back to TB2. PLC closes the relay when SV-TREAT opens (T-102 calling for fill).
| Pump | Mineral | PLC output | Receptacle | Voltage |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| MP-A | Magnesium sulfate (MgSO₄) | Slot 2 / Y3.NO | NEMA 5-15R | 120 VAC |
| MP-B | Calcium chloride (CaCl₂) | Slot 2 / Y4.NO | NEMA 5-15R | 120 VAC |
| MP-C | Sodium bicarbonate (NaHCO₃) | Slot 2 / Y5.NO | NEMA 5-15R | 120 VAC |
The pump's onboard digital display sets dosing rate per the active HMI recipe.
The relay just enables/disables the pump. Future upgrade path is 4–20 mA
proportional rate control from the PLC into the pump's AR analog input.
Per-Pump Protection
- Branch: CB-4 =
GMCBU-1C-20, 20 A 1P (shared with PLC PSU, HMI PSU, UV) - Per-load fuse: 5 × 20 mm midget fuse on a
DN-T12-Afuse block, 0.25 A per pump (UV gets ~1 A) - Ground: dedicated green per receptacle back to panel ground bus
A per-load fuse keeps a single pump short from tripping the 20 A branch breaker and dropping the PLC / HMI / UV with it.
Load Numbers
| Parameter | Value |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Max power input (P1) per pump | 22 W | Grundfos catalog, Product 98586903 |
| Steady-state current per pump @ 120 V | ~0.18 A | 22 W ÷ 120 V |
| All three pumps, steady state | ~0.55 A | ~66 W total |
| Inrush current per pump | ~25 A for ~2 ms @ 230 V | Use Type C MCB equivalent; stagger PLC enables |
| CB-4 branch budget headroom | comfortable | UV ~1 A + PSUs + 3 × pumps ≪ 20 A |
Stagger note: the PLC ladder should not energise Y3 / Y4 / Y5 in the same scan. Add a small per-pump delay (e.g. 50–100 ms staggered) so the three ~25 A inrush spikes don't sum on the same branch.
Pump Cord Re-Termination
Factory cord on each procured DDC 6-10 (Made in France, EU production run) is 1.5 m with an EU plug. Two acceptable options:
- Re-terminate to NEMA 5-15P at the cord end and plug into the panel-fed receptacle. Simpler; preserves the strain relief.
- Hard-wire into the panel at TB2 with the factory cord cut to length. Cleaner install; loses the easy field swap.
Pick at panel build; document in the as-built.
